David Merrill’s First Principles of Instruction:

Activation - learning is promoted when learners activate relevant cognitive structures.
Demonstration - learning is promoted when learners observe a demonstration of the skills to be learned
Application - learning is promoted when learners apply their newly acquired knowledge and skill
